Vassar College has a 18% acceptance rate with a middle 50% SAT range of 1370-1510 and average GPA of 3.85. Originally a women's college, now co-ed with strong arts and interdisciplinary programs. Founded 1861 in Poughkeepsie, NY.
| Acceptance Rate | 18%Highly Selective |
| SAT Range (25th-75th) | 1370 - 1510 |
| Average GPA (Unweighted) | 3.85 |
| Undergraduate Enrollment | 2,450 |
| School Type | Private |
| Location | Poughkeepsie, NY |
| Founded | 1861 |
| Test Policy | Test-Optional |
| Need-Blind | Yes |
| Meets 100% Need | Yes |

The middle 50% SAT range for Vassar is 1370-1510. Scoring above 1510 does not guarantee admission, and scoring below 1370 does not mean rejection — holistic review considers the full application.
The average unweighted GPA of admitted students at Vassar is approximately 3.85. Course rigor (AP/IB/dual enrollment) matters as much as the GPA number itself.
